2010 Kia Sorento spied again, this time in the United States
Looks like Kia has now begun testing the next-generation SUV in the United States, and these are the pictures showing the new SUV with the least disguise yet. This new design language reminds us Acura little bit.
As is obvious in these pictures, the Sorento will be growing but won’t accommodate three rows of seating as was was specualted earlier. This part will be left to the yet bigger Kia Borrego. In addition to the larger size, the Sorento will also move upscale – including higher prices and bigger engines.

2010 Kia Sorento interior spied
First time we saw the next-generation Kia Sorento was back in August, in Death Valley. In addition to all the previous exterior shots we now have the first interior images as well.
New Sorento features unibody architecture instead if a separate body-on-frame chassis that’s been used in the previous Sorento vehicles. This mean better handling and improved fuel economy.
Kia Sorento will be first offered with a 2.4-liter gasoline or 2.0 and 2.2 liter diesel engines. No information will the diesel be offered in the states as well. 3.8-liter V6 that produces 260 hp will also be available soon after the launch.
